5.9 Display Control (F8)

F8.00 Accumulated length
This parameter records the accumulated length value. If
No.39 function in Table 5-3 (clear length) is enabled, the
length will be added to this parameter, but if F9.15 (actual
length) is changed to 0 manually, the previous record before
the modification will not be added.
If you change this parameter, you just modify the history
record, no other effect.

F8.01 and F8.02 define the parameters that can be
displayed by LED when the drive is operating. If Bit is set at
0, the parameter will not be displayed;
If Bit is set at 1, the parameter will be displayed.

The displayed terminal information includes status of
terminal X1~X5, bi-direction open-collector output terminals
Y1 and Y2, and relay output terminal TC. The status of
terminals are indicated by the "On" or "Off' of LED. If the LED
turns on, that means the terminal is enabled, and the
terminal is disabled if the LED turns off, as shown in
Figure5-53:
